Calling (The)

Country: United States, Language: English, 107 mins

  • Director: B. Danielle Watkins
  • Writer: B. Danielle Watkins
  • Producer: Onyx Keesha, B. Danielle Watkins

CGiii Comment

The love of God comes at no cost to those who seek him with a humble, open heart. Religion teaches this, but not every church teaches the same unconditional love God is supposed to represent. Tamar has been called to become a minister, and for most, this would be an honorable moment, but for Tamar, it is the worst thing that could have happened. Tamar is the middle lesbian daughter of Deacon Jessup “Jessie” Arthur, and Evangelist Allison Arthur. Tamar has been taught that her desires are not that of God, so she has suppressed them for the last 16 years and has never dated a woman despite it being what she truly wants. It’s only when she meets Pastor Monica Smith that things are put into perspective, and she can return to the church with a new mindset, space, and objective: to teach love and understanding through her own faith walk.
